Output 3ef24fbb1fe24b9da9c64a767e98053e66b919e60d850815bf485d55bed02c77:26

value
700432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42543339a6ad5376c861a1814f99bcf3eb556b7d OP_EQUAL
address
37jjPXh3yakQF4aDR1aQaWHH9pbxcEQ3me
transaction
3ef24fbb1fe24b9da9c64a767e98053e66b919e60d850815bf485d55bed02c77
spent
true